The Sweet Moment That Sparked Controversy
Hilton posted an adorable video showcasing a playful interaction with her 15-month-old daughter, London. In the clip, Hilton discovers her daughter rummaging through her designer purses, a scene that many would find endearing. “Hi Princess! Are you getting into my purses?” she asks, kneeling down to engage with London, who is clearly captivated by the colorful accessories. The video captures a tender moment of bonding, with Hilton even hinting at a future purse line for her daughter, the "London Hilton Line."
Despite the heartwarming nature of the video, it didn’t take long for the mom-shamers to emerge. Critics flooded the comments section with negative remarks, questioning the bond between Hilton and her daughter. Comments like “Why do I feel like there is absolutely NO relationship between them?” and “She doesn’t know who the hell u are…” reflect a disturbing trend where online users feel entitled to judge the authenticity of a mother-child relationship based solely on a brief video clip.

Support Amidst the Negativity
Fortunately, not all comments were negative. Many users rallied to Hilton’s defense, highlighting the importance of understanding child development and the nuances of parenting. Supportive comments pointed out that young children often exhibit shyness and that it’s unfair to judge the relationship between a mother and her child based on a single interaction. One user noted, “I think the kids in general are really shy,” reminding others that every child is different and may respond in their unique way.
Hilton herself responded to the negativity with grace, stating, “Seriously, she is one year old, she is just learning to talk. Some people are just hateful individuals.” Her ability to rise above the criticism and focus on her daughter’s development is commendable and serves as a powerful message to other mothers facing similar scrutiny.
